The ABC'S of Receiving Christ

 

    ADMIT that YOU are a sinner. Everyone has done things that displease a Holy God. God tells us that no sin can enter heaven. Something must be done to get rid of your sin.
    Romans 3:23 "All have sinned and come short of the glory of God.",
Revelation 21:27 "And there shall in no wise enter into it (heaven) any thing that defileth, neither whatsoever worketh abomination, or maketh a lie: but they which are written in the Lamb's book of life."

    BELIEVE that Jesus died on the cross for YOU. God loves you and wants you to become His child. He loves you so much that He sent His Son, Jesus, to shed His blood to save YOU from YOUR sins. He took YOUR place on the cross, and suffered the punishment for YOUR sin. Believe that He died for your sins, was buried, and rose again the third day.
    1 Peter 2:24 "Who His own self (Jesus) bore our sins in His own body on the tree (cross) that we, being dead to sins, should live unto righteousness."
Colossians 1:14 "In whom we have redemption (salvation) through His (Jesus') blood, even the forgiveness of sins."
Acts 16:31 "Believe on the Lord Jesus Christ, and thou shalt be saved."

    CONFESS your sinfulness to God, and turn from it. Tell God you're sorry for your sins and that you believe in Jesus and accept Him as your Savior from sin. This may be a simple but sincere cry from your heart, or it may be expressed out loud.
    Luke 18:13 "God be merciful to me a sinner."
Romans 10:9 "If thou shalt confess with thy mouth the Lord Jesus, and shalt believe in thine heart that God hath raised Him from the dead, thou shalt be saved."
Romans 10:13 "Whosoever shall call upon the name of the Lord shall be saved."
    If you believe in Jesus and have placed your faith and trust in Him, you, along with all the others who believe in Jesus, will spend eternity in heaven with Him.
